DeciDesk covers the full decision-making chain: collect agenda items, build dossiers, submit motions, record votes, publish decisions. All on typed registers with an audit trail that makes Woo compliance much simpler later.
Agendas with dossier creation.
One dossier per agenda item: official advice, council documents, presentations, answered questions. All versioned, all in OpenRegister.
Motions and amendments.
Submit, link to an agenda item, record votes. Per faction or per individual, configurable per board.
Voting, including proxy voting, tracked in the audit trail.
In person, by show of hands, electronically, or by proxy for an absent member. Outcome, individual votes, abstentions. All in a tamper-evident log.
eIDAS-qualified signatures on minutes and resolutions.
Minutes and written-procedure resolutions are signed with a qualified electronic signature (QES) under eIDAS Article 25(2), verified end to end before the record is finalised.
Decisions as published documents, with governance reports.
DocuDesk generates the formal decision from vote results and discussion. OpenCatalogi publishes it on yourmunicipality.nl/decisions with citation-stable URLs; governance reports and regulator exports cover the compliance side.

Install DeciDesk and the workspace chat gets five governance tools. The AI can list your open action items, browse meetings, open a dossier, start a meeting from a calendar event, or capture a follow-up, all under the caller's own role and auth.
List open action items
Incomplete action items assigned to the caller, or all visible items. Scope mine / all, capped at 50.
List recent meetings
Recent meetings for the caller, newest first. Optional status filter: scheduled, in-progress, or closed.
Get meeting details
Full dossier for one meeting: agenda, participants, action items, decisions, attached files.
Start meeting
Move a scheduled meeting into in-progress. Requires chair or admin role; logged in the audit trail.
Add action item
Create a new action item under a meeting, assigned to a participant, with optional due date.
